Voluntary Winding-up of an Active, Compliant Private Limited Company

What is the process for voluntary winding-up of a 5-year old Active, Compliant Private Limited Company with no creditors, no assets and no business in the last 1 year. GST registration was surrendered 1 year ago. All ROC and IT Returns have been duly filed till date. DPT-3 and all other compliances have also been taken care of. 

 

Replies (1)

Since your company is "active and compliant" but currently has no assets, no creditors, and no business operations, you should pursue the Strike-off route (Form STK-2). It is the standard procedure for closing a dormant entity that has already cleared its statutory filings. Consult a Company Secretary (CS) or Chartered Accountant (CA) to assist with the preparation of the indemnity bond and the CA-certified statement of accounts to ensure the application is processed without objection from the Registrar.
